Positions in this function perform in a lead delivery role on projects for customers internal to UHG and external to UHG, that leverage large data sets, both traditional and proprietary to Optum, to drive improvements in financial, clinical, and operational performance. Successful candidate will be able to work effectively within large multi-disciplined teams, as well as mentor, manage, and teach younger actuaries. Critical thinking, ability to clearly communicate complex topics, strong willingness to mentor and be mentored, and passion for leveraging predictive analytics are keys to success.

You'll enjoy the flexibility to work remotely * from anywhere within the U.S. as you take on some tough challenges.

Primary Responsibilities:

  • Bring traditional actuarial skills to payer organizations as the health care market continues to evolve, including:
    • Assist in developing innovative analytics and strategies to drive measurable performance
    • Leverage Optum's immense data sets and platforms along with client data to provide insights and actionable strategies through predictive analytics
    • Interpret, compile, and disseminate results of modeling analyses with appropriate conclusions and recommendations to assist in client decision making and strategic direction
    • Lead meetings across various clients, Optum's multi-disciplinary teams
    • Potential areas of focus may include but are not limited to: Healthcare Economics, benchmarking analysis, value-based contract feasibility analysis, and population health analytics
    • Develop professionally within an actuarial team, while collaborating with other clinicians, business analysts, and strategy consultants

You'll be rewarded and recognized for your performance in an environment that will challenge you and give you clear direction on what it takes to succeed in your role as well as provide development for other roles you may be interested in.

Required Qualifications:

  • ASA or FSA credential
  • 5+ years of healthcare experience
  • 3+ years of consulting experience either in consulting firm or internal consulting within a payer
  • 2+ years of Commercial actuarial experience
  • 2+ years of experience with SAS, R, and/or Python

Preferred Qualification:

  • Solid desire to advance the actuarial profession through use of predictive analytics and AI/Machine learning
